Jiangtao Wang is a scholar working on Materials Chemistry, Astronomy and Astrophysics and Electrical and Electronic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Jiangtao Wang has authored 28 papers receiving a total of 238 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 11 papers in Materials Chemistry, 11 papers in Astronomy and Astrophysics and 5 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ering. Recurrent topics in Jiangtao Wang’s work include Stellar, planetary, and galactic studies (10 papers), Astro and Planetary Science (7 papers) and Astrophysics and Star Formation Studies (7 papers). Jiangtao Wang is often cited by papers focused on Stellar, planetary, and galactic studies (10 papers), Astro and Planetary Science (7 papers) and Astrophysics and Star Formation Studies (7 papers). Jiangtao Wang collaborates with scholars based in China, Switzerland and United Kingdom. Jiangtao Wang's co-authors include Yuwen Liu, Wu Yuan, Chenguang Huang, Hongwei Song, Xiaowei Yin, Zhenjie Zhao, Sang‐Bing Tsai, Yuzhao Ma, Xin Li and Qing Zhang and has published in prestigious journals such as The Astrophysical Journal, Applied Physics Letters and PLoS ONE.
